Biography

Marie-Sophie Nélisse (born March 27, 2000) is a Canadian actress. She is known for her Genie Award–winning performance in Monsieur Lazhar and for her portrayal of Liesel Meminger in the film adaptation of the novel The Book Thief. Nélisse was born in Windsor, Ontario, but moved to Montréal, Québec, with her family when she was four. She is of French Canadian descent. Besides her Genie Award for Monsieur Lazhar, she won a Jutra Award for her performance and a Young Artist Award nomination as Best Leading Young Actress in an International Feature Film. She also had roles in the film Ésimésac and in a Québec sitcom called Les Parent. Her sister is actress Isabelle Nélisse.
